I went out to take the Vette to pick up my son and it wouldnt start! It cranks and turns over but wont start! I last drove it on Sunday! A few weeks ago I posted that when i went to drive it it flashed sys by the speedo and someone said it was the battery but never done it again after that one time! Do i need a new battery or what..Like i said it cranks and the lights and everything comes on please help!
check your battery with an voltmeter, but if it cranks strong that is strange.
put, a charger on it and try it, or jump it if it starts go buy a battery
are you getting fuel to the motor?
Could be a battery, I would try that first. It sounds more like an open ignition circuit, due to either an ignition module issue or a alarm system issue. You'll need to check the codes. Same thing happened to my 93, it was fine one moment and would only crank the next. Mine was a control module causing an open ignition circuit error. If it were the VATS system, there would be no crank at all.
Ensure you're getting spark and if so, check for fuel pressure.
Checking spark is easy pull the #1 plug wire stick a screw driver in it place about a inch away from exhaust crank motor see if it sparks. For fuel pressure you will need a gague on the fuel rail
